Output ef6d6911460e3094ddb2b60c72dbed59735e154e16ae1205c3be38ef002d619c:1

value
3334679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40a752c6522a5e274f4a14127b7107e6409cb91a OP_EQUALVERIFY OP_CHECKSIG
address
16trh7BNFzYf4vuEmKUZMBVicgn3BBPsgD
transaction
ef6d6911460e3094ddb2b60c72dbed59735e154e16ae1205c3be38ef002d619c
spent
true